Magnolia grandiflora 'Kay Parris'

Kay Parris Magnolia

One of the very best evergreen magnolias. Small tree or multi-stemmed shrub with very large, glossy, green leaves and a deep orange-brown, velvety underside. The large flowers smell wonderfully of lemon.

where to plant Magnolia grandiflora 'Kay Parris'

  • height: 350-400 cm
  • flowering: June - September
  • color: creamy yellow white cream
  • leaf color: brown-red dark green
  • scent: particularly fragrant
  • habit: ascending
  • growth: medium
  • level: easy
  • light: full sun sunny morning sun evening sun
  • moisture: dry average moist
  • soil texture: light normal
  • organic matter: normal high
  • winter zone: 7 [-15°C]
  • density: 1 - 2

Magnolia grandiflora 'Kay Parris' in the garden

  • Suggested planting locations and garden types: shrub border pot planters small garden park

botanical information about Magnolia grandiflora 'Kay Parris'

  • Botanical name: Magnolia grandiflora 'Kay Parris'
  • Genus: Magnolia
  • Family: Magnoliaceae
  • Other names: Kay Parris Magnolia
  • PARENTAGE: 'M. Little Gem' x M. 'Bracken's Brown Beauty'
  • Breeder: Gilberts Nursery Inc
  • origin: hybrid
